Sacramento's 20-Year Plan Set to Make Bold Moves in Housing Equity and Sustainability

Curated by Trao Thao

The project was launched in 2019 and presents an exciting opportunity to shape the city’s trajectory for the next two decades. Through extensive community engagement, it addresses pressing issues such as housing affordability, equity, and sustainability, reflecting a commitment to inclusive and environmentally responsible urban development. Notably, the plan introduces innovative strategies to mitigate climate change effects and foster diverse, accessible housing options, positioning Sacramento as a leader in progressive city planning.

As a Prohousing designated city in California, Sacramento’s approach serves as a model for equitable growth and community development nationwide. With the upcoming City Council review on February 27th and implementation set for March 28th, anticipation is high for the transformative impact this project will have on Sacramento’s future.
